Flyent is a very good way to practice and develop your understanding of the lithuanian language with little effort. It provides audio tracks that you can listen in loops, to slowly allow your brain to acquire the language. I personally use it while walking in the city, running errands etc. The audio tracks are grouped by difficulty level, which means you can start using the app no matter your current level. The best part in my opinion is that audio tracks come with transcription and translation to english (or russian). That means you can associate the audio with a meaning, even if you're a complete beginner (something you couldn't do just by listening to the radio).
